Transaction 508ea178802114749bc6eff0ca0c6a794122d4af7d1a635ed7be3b4b5249c397

1 Input
2 Outputs
  • 508ea178802114749bc6eff0ca0c6a794122d4af7d1a635ed7be3b4b5249c397:0
  • value  3344302
    address  3F44nwybqxyMeJNbHbyybCyaQU1ZmoJQfT
  • 508ea178802114749bc6eff0ca0c6a794122d4af7d1a635ed7be3b4b5249c397:1
  • value  1679194269
    address  3D2YJHvQQWaCRGQfSEVaYvfTSpmBJN1BEU